apkfuckery/com.discord/res/layout/widget_payment_source_edit_...

38 lines
5.9 KiB
XML

<?xml version="1.0" encoding="utf-8"?>
<LinearLayout style="@style/UiKit.ViewGroup.Page.LinearLayout"
x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to">
<androidx.appcompat.widget.Toolbar app:navigationContentDescription="@string/close" app:navigationIcon="?ic_action_bar_close" app:title="@string/payment_source_edit_title" style="@style/AppTheme.Toolbar">
<com.discord.views.LoadingButton android:layout_gravity="end|center" android:id="@id/dialog_save" android:background="?selectableItemBackgroundBorderless" android:layout_width="wrap_content" android:layout_height="wrap_content" android:layout_marginStart="8.0dip" android:layout_marginEnd="16.0dip" app:lb_progress_color="?primary_100_alpha_60" app:lb_text="@string/save" app:lb_text_color="?primary_100" />
</androidx.appcompat.widget.Toolbar>
<androidx.core.widget.NestedScrollView android:layout_weight="1.0" style="@style/UiKit.ViewGroup.NestedScrollView">
<LinearLayout android:paddingBottom="@dimen/list_bottom_padding" android:layout_marginLeft="16.0dip" android:layout_marginRight="16.0dip" style="@style/UiKit.ViewGroup.LinearLayout">
<TextView android:textColor="@color/primary_100" android:gravity="center_vertical" android:id="@id/payment_source_edit_error" android:background="@drawable/drawable_button_red" android:padding="8.0dip" android:visibility="gone" android:layout_width="fill_parent" android:drawablePadding="8.0dip" app:drawableStartCompat="@drawable/ic_info_outline_white_24dp" style="@style/UiKit.TextView" />
<com.discord.widgets.settings.billing.PaymentSourceView android:id="@id/payment_source_summary" android:layout_width="fill_parent" android:layout_height="wrap_content" android:layout_marginTop="16.0dip" android:layout_marginBottom="8.0dip" />
<TextView android:id="@id/payment_source_edit_help" android:layout_marginBottom="8.0dip" android:text="@string/payment_source_edit_help_card" style="@style/UiKit.TextView.Subtext" />
<TextView android:layout_marginTop="8.0dip" android:text="@string/billing_address" style="@style/UiKit.TextView.H2" />
<com.google.android.material.textfield.TextInputLayout android:id="@id/payment_source_edit_name" android:hint="@string/billing_address_name" style="@style/UiKit.TextInputLayout.Primary">
<com.google.android.material.textfield.TextInputEditText android:inputType="textPersonName" style="@style/UiKit.TextInputLayout.EditText" />
</com.google.android.material.textfield.TextInputLayout>
<com.google.android.material.textfield.TextInputLayout android:id="@id/payment_source_edit_address1" android:hint="@string/billing_address_address" style="@style/UiKit.TextInputLayout.Primary">
<com.google.android.material.textfield.TextInputEditText android:inputType="textPostalAddress" style="@style/UiKit.TextInputLayout.EditText" />
</com.google.android.material.textfield.TextInputLayout>
<com.google.android.material.textfield.TextInputLayout android:id="@id/payment_source_edit_address2" android:hint="@string/billing_address_address2" style="@style/UiKit.TextInputLayout.Primary">
<com.google.android.material.textfield.TextInputEditText style="@style/UiKit.TextInputLayout.EditText" />
</com.google.android.material.textfield.TextInputLayout>
<com.google.android.material.textfield.TextInputLayout android:id="@id/payment_source_edit_city" android:hint="@string/billing_address_city" style="@style/UiKit.TextInputLayout.Primary">
<com.google.android.material.textfield.TextInputEditText style="@style/UiKit.TextInputLayout.EditText" />
</com.google.android.material.textfield.TextInputLayout>
<com.google.android.material.textfield.TextInputLayout android:id="@id/payment_source_edit_state" android:hint="@string/billing_address_state" app:endIconDrawable="?ic_navigate_next" app:endIconMode="custom" style="@style/UiKit.TextInputLayout.Primary">
<com.google.android.material.textfield.TextInputEditText android:imeOptions="actionGo" style="@style/UiKit.TextInputLayout.EditText.NoFocus" />
</com.google.android.material.textfield.TextInputLayout>
<com.google.android.material.textfield.TextInputLayout android:id="@id/payment_source_edit_postal_code" android:hint="@string/billing_address_zip_code" style="@style/UiKit.TextInputLayout.Primary">
<com.google.android.material.textfield.TextInputEditText android:nextFocusRight="@id/dialog_save" android:imeOptions="actionDone" android:nextFocusForward="@id/dialog_save" style="@style/UiKit.TextInputLayout.EditText" />
</com.google.android.material.textfield.TextInputLayout>
<com.google.android.material.textfield.TextInputLayout android:id="@id/payment_source_edit_country" android:focusable="false" android:hint="@string/billing_address_country" app:endIconDrawable="@drawable/ic_lock_white_a60_16dp" app:endIconMode="custom" style="@style/UiKit.TextInputLayout.Primary">
<com.google.android.material.textfield.TextInputEditText android:enabled="false" android:textColor="?primary_400" android:inputType="none" style="@style/UiKit.TextInputLayout.EditText" />
</com.google.android.material.textfield.TextInputLayout>
<CheckBox android:id="@id/payment_source_edit_default" android:layout_marginTop="8.0dip" android:checked="true" android:text="@string/payment_source_make_default" app:buttonTint="@color/brand_500" style="@style/UiKit.Checkbox" />
<com.google.android.material.button.MaterialButton android:id="@id/dialog_delete" android:layout_marginTop="24.0dip" android:layout_marginBottom="24.0dip" android:text="@string/payment_source_delete" style="@style/UiKit.Material.Button.Red.Outline" />
</LinearLayout>
</androidx.core.widget.NestedScrollView>
</LinearLayout>